These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Bethel area can be challenging. Home prices in Bethel are now at a median cost of $177,401, lower than the Louisiana average of $194,522.
The average cost of rent is $882/mo in Bethel,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Bethel area. While nearly 84.57% of residents own their homes outright in Bethel, 25.58%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Bethel is $2,937 per month. Households that rent pay about 30.03% of their income on rent here. Bethel's most expensive areas are in the central regions, while the cheapest areas are in the northwestern parts of the city.
